Discover the Timeless Charm of Uji, Japan
Nestled along the serene banks of the Uji River, Uji is a captivating city that harmoniously blends rich history with natural beauty. Renowned as one of Japan's oldest cities, Uji is home to exquisite temples and shrines, including the UNESCO World Heritage Site, Byodoin Temple, famous for its stunning Phoenix Hall. Visitors can wander through the meticulously maintained gardens, where cherry blossoms bloom in spring, painting the landscape in delicate shades of pink. The tranquil atmosphere invites leisurely strolls along the river, where you can take in the picturesque views of traditional wooden houses and lush greenery that line the water's edge. Uji is also celebrated for its exceptional matcha, or powdered green tea, which has been cultivated in the region for centuries. Tea enthusiasts can indulge in tastings at local tea houses, where the rich flavors and vibrant colors of Uji's matcha come to life. The city hosts various tea-related events, offering visitors a unique opportunity to learn about the art of tea preparation and the cultural significance it holds in Japanese society. Whether you’re exploring ancient temples, enjoying a cup of the finest matcha, or simply soaking in the breathtaking landscapes, Uji promises an unforgettable experience that captures the essence of Japan's heritage and natural splendor.
